The Intercom Integration for Zoho CRM connects Intercom messaging with Zoho CRM to provide complete visibility into customer conversations. With this integration, sales and support teams can view Intercom contacts, companies, and conversation history directly within Zoho CRM.
This integration allows teams to manage customer communication without switching between platforms. By bringing Intercom chat activity into Zoho CRM, organizations can track customer engagement, respond faster to inquiries, and maintain a unified view of customer interactions.
Should have a Zoho CRM account
Should have an Intercom account.
Should have Intercom Sender email IDs.
View and reply to Intercom conversations from inside Zoho CRM lead/contact records
Compose new outbound Intercom messages directly from a CRM record
Access chat history from within Zoho CRM modules
Sync messages and message assignees between Intercom and Zoho CRM
Map Intercom agents to corresponding Zoho CRM users
Step 1: Go to the Zoho CRM marketplace and install "Intercom for Zoho CRM" to initiate the installation process.
Step 2: Check both consent boxes and click the "Continue" button to install the extension in Zoho CRM.
Step 3: Select the Zoho CRM profiles for which the app has to be installed and click "Confirm" to proceed further.
Step 4: You will be redirected to the settings page—log in to the integration using your email or Google sign-in options.
Step 5: Choose the Datacenter Region for your Zoho CRM Account. Click the "Authorize Zoho CRM" button to initiate the Zoho CRM authorization.
Step 6: Check the authorization box and click "Accept" to grant access and complete the Zoho CRM authorization.
Step 7: Click the "I've Authorized - Refresh" button to proceed further.
Step 8: Click the "Authorize Intercom" button to authorize your Intercom account.
Step 9: Click the "Authorize access" button to finish the Intercom authorization.
Step 10: Click the "I've Authorized - Refresh" button to proceed further.
Step 1: In the settings page that you're redirected to, click the "App Users" option to add the Zoho CRM users.
Step 2: Click the "Add" button to add the Zoho CRM users.
Step 3: Navigate back to the settings page and click the "Incoming Sync" setting to enable the option to receive incoming messages.
Step 4: Choose the module (e.g., Leads) where incoming messages will create records, enable the toggle options to save attachments to Zoho CRM records and get real-time notifications in Zoho CRM. There is also an option to ignore messages from new customers, which can be enabled to sync messages only for customers who already exist in Zoho CRM.
Step 5: Navigate back to the settings page and click the "Users Mapping" option to map the Intercom users with the Zoho CRM users.
Step 6: Map each Intercom user to the corresponding Zoho CRM user to ensure conversations are assigned to the correct user.
Step 7: Close the settings page and navigate to the inbox page. Choose an Intercom conversation to respond to.
Step 8: Change the assignee of this conversation to see it reflected in Intercom. Similarly, any assignee changes made in Intercom will be reflected here, enabling two-way sync of assignees between Intercom and Zoho CRM
Step 9: Navigate back to the Zoho CRM's home page. and choose the "Intercom Messages" module.
Since the "Incoming Sync" setting has been enabled in the integration, the incoming messages will be creating records in the "Intercom Messages" module within the Zoho CRM.
Step 10: Navigate to the leads module and choose any of the leads created from the Intercom's incoming messages.
Step 11: Scroll down on the lead's page to find the "Intercom Inbox" section where you can view all the Intercom message conversations within the Zoho CRM. Click the "Compose" icon to send an outgoing message to the lead from directly within the Zoho CRM.
Step 12: Choose a sender, the recipient will be auto-fetched from the lead record, then type a message or use a template to send an outgoing message from the Zoho CRM.
Step 13: Click the "Send Message" button.
Step 14: A confirmation message indicating that the message has been sent successfully can be seen.
Step 15: Navigate to your Intercom account to view the sent message.
Step 16: Now, send a message from the Intercom.
Step 17: Navigate back to the Zoho CRM tab. The message sent from Intercom will be reflected in the Intercom inbox within Zoho CRM. This demonstrates how two-way message syncing works between Intercom and Zoho CRM.
